Personally I think binge watching is one of the joys of the modern world
When I was young I loved nothing better than discovering a good long book, or trilogy, and then getting lost in it. In Year 7 I stalled reading
The Hobbit for a class book review for as long as possible as it sounded daggy. But I loved it and so looked to see what else the author had written that was in our school library. I found
The Lord of the Rings and nirvana was mine. Only problem was that it was the end of the last term and the library was closing on Friday till next year and it was Monday! So I read the three books in five days. That was the start of my looking for and ready good 1000 pagers if I could find them.
Many years later I was on a flight back from Europe and was browsing through what was on the IVR and did not see any movies that I had not already seen when I noticed
Game Of Thrones. My daughters had been hooked on GOT for a while along with another show called
Breaking Bad, both of which I had dismissed as not my cup of tea. I mean why would I want to watch a show based a teacher making drugs!!
So with the lack of movies on offer I thought I might as well give GOT a go, and bam I was hooked. I watch I think it was about 6 episodes all in a row, and on return home I quickly caught up on the other episodes I had mot yet seen.
Then Breaking Bad... and then..... Yes I had rediscovered my 100 pagers in a different form.
Now as to binge watching I won't normally sit down at watch all weekend etc. But I will watch say a series say most nights till it is finished, and I might watch to or even three episodes in a row. I find this really allows you to escape into the characters and plot-lines more.
Now I don't only watch series as I will say escape hiking with no technology. But when I discover a new series I really like (and by that I mean a GOOD one and not just any series), or a new series of a past favourite comes out, it is a little bit like Christmas for me and that buzz I got from reading Lord of the Rings that first time is rekindled.
